The import of coconuts, Brazil nuts, and cashew nuts to Nicaragua has shown a consistent upward trend since 2024. From a 2023 base, the forecast data highlights an average annual growth or CAGR of around 3.2% over the next five years. Notably, the year-on-year increase from 2024 to 2025 is approximately 3.4%, indicating stable demand. As of 2024, the import value stands at 124.24 thousand US dollars.
